For many DIY enthusiasts and professional mechanics, having a well-equipped garage workshop is essential for getting the job done efficiently Whether you are working on your car, woodworking projects, or other repairs, having the right equipment can make all the difference In this article, we will explore the various types of equipment that are essential for a fully functional garage workshop.
1 Workbench: A sturdy workbench is the foundation of any garage workshop It provides a flat surface for working on projects, assembling parts, and conducting repairs Look for a workbench that is made of durable materials such as steel or hardwood, and has enough space to accommodate your projects Some workbenches also come with built-in storage drawers and shelves for easy organization.
2 Tool storage: Keeping your tools organized and easily accessible is crucial in a garage workshop Invest in a tool chest or cabinet to store your hand tools, power tools, and other equipment Consider wall-mounted pegboards, shelves, and hooks for smaller tools and accessories Having a designated place for each tool will save you time and frustration when working on projects.
3 Power tools: Power tools are essential for cutting, drilling, sanding, and shaping materials in a garage workshop Some common power tools include drills, circular saws, jigsaws, sanders, and grinders Make sure to invest in quality brands that are reliable and durable Additionally, consider purchasing cordless versions of power tools for added convenience and mobility.
4 Air compressor: An air compressor is a versatile tool that can power pneumatic tools, inflate tires, and clean surfaces with compressed air Look for an air compressor that has a sufficient tank size and horsepower rating for your needs Consider portable models for easy transport around your garage workshop.
5 Lighting: Proper lighting is essential for working in a garage workshop, especially when working on intricate projects or repairs Install overhead LED lights or task lighting to illuminate your work area and reduce eye strain garage workshop equipment. Consider adding adjustable lights or work lamps for focused lighting on specific tasks.
6 Safety equipment: Safety should always be a top priority in a garage workshop Invest in safety equipment such as eye protection, ear protection, gloves, and dust masks to protect yourself while working Consider installing a fire extinguisher, first aid kit, and emergency exits in case of accidents or emergencies.
7 Bench grinder: A bench grinder is a versatile tool for sharpening blades, shaping metal, and grinding materials Look for a bench grinder with adjustable speed settings and sturdy construction Consider adding different grinding wheels for various tasks such as sharpening, buffing, and polishing.
8 Vise: A bench vise is a handy tool for holding materials in place while cutting, drilling, or shaping Look for a vise with a sturdy grip and adjustable jaws for holding different sizes of materials Consider mounting the vise on your workbench for added stability and convenience.
9 Welding equipment: If you are interested in metalworking or fabrication, consider investing in welding equipment for your garage workshop A welding machine, helmet, gloves, and safety gear are essential for welding projects Take proper training and safety precautions when using welding equipment to prevent accidents and injuries.
10 Storage solutions: Organization is key in a garage workshop to maximize space and efficiency Consider adding shelves, cabinets, and bins for storing materials, parts, and tools Use labels and storage containers to keep everything in its place and easily accessible when needed.
